Japanese displayed incorrectly

Hello!

I've searched through the forum and calibre wiki and could not find anything that managed to solve my problem, so I'm sorry if this has already been asked.

As shown in the attached picture, when I open an epub with Japanese everything, including Latin letters is rotated. Personally, I'd prefer if I could read the text from top to down rather than left to right (although it can't be helped if rotating the page is the only option, though I could not find how to do that).

I use the calibre desktop app (3.31.0) on Linux Mint, but have the same problem on a Windows environment.

I'm sorry if this a trivial/newbie question but I just couldn't find a solution no matter where in the preferences/options or internet I looked.

The calibre viewer has no support for vertical text, however, if you upgrae to calibre 4 you will find that vertical text is at least displayed correctly though you wont be able to scroll.
